A curated list of papers on Visual Place Recognition and related fields, inspired by awesome-NeRF. PRs are very much appreciated.
- Visual Place Recognition: A Tutorial, Stefan Schubert et al., RAM 2023 | bibtex
- Place recognition survey: An update on deep learning approaches, Tiago Barros et al., ArXiv 2022 | bibtex
- General Place Recognition Survey: Towards the Real-world Autonomy Age, Peng Yin et al., ArXiv 2022 | bibtex
- A Survey on Deep Visual Place Recognition, Carlo Masone et al., IEEE Access 2021 | bibtex
- Visual place recognition: A survey from deep learning perspective, Xiwu Zhang et al., Pattern Recognition 2021 | bibtex
- Where is your place, Visual Place Recognition?, Sourav Garg et al., IJCAI 2021 | bibtex
- Visual Place Recognition: A Survey, Stephanie Lowry et al., IEEE Transactions on Robotics 2016 | bibtex
Papers are roughly split into categories, and a paper can (rarely) appear in more than one category.
Standard VPR
- Optimal Transport Aggregation for Visual Place Recognition, Sergio Izquierdo et al., CVPR 2024 | github | bibtex
- CricaVPR: Cross-image Correlation-aware Representation Learning for Visual Place Recognition, Feng Lu et al., CVPR 2024 | github | bibtex
- EigenPlaces: Training Viewpoint Robust Models for Visual Place Recognition, Gabriele Berton et al., ICCV 2023 | github | bibtex
- AnyLoc: Towards Universal Visual Place Recognition, Nikhil Keetha et al., ArXiv 2023 | github | bibtex
- MixVPR: Feature Mixing for Visual Place Recognition, Ali-bey Amar et al., WACV 2023 | github | bibtex
- Data-efficient Large Scale Place Recognition with Graded Similarity Supervision, María Leyva-Vallina et al., CVPR 2023 | github | bibtex
- Rethinking Visual Geo-localization for Large-Scale Applications, Berton Gabriele et al., CVPR 2022 | github | bibtex
- GSV-Cities: Toward appropriate supervised visual place recognition, Ali-bey Amar et al., Neurocomputing 2022 | github | bibtex
- Learning Semantics for Visual Place Recognition through Multi-Scale Attention, Valerio Paolicelli et al., ICIAP 2022 | github | bibtex
- Attentional Pyramid Pooling of Salient Visual Residuals for Place Recognition, Peng Guohao et al., ICCV 2021 | bibtex
- Vector of Locally and Adaptively Aggregated Descriptors for Image Feature Representation, Jian Zhang et al., PR 2021 | bibtex
- Semantic Reinforced Attention Learning for Visual Place Recognition, Guohao Peng et al., ICRA 2021 | bibtex
- Self-supervising Fine-Grained Region Similarities for Large-Scale Image Localization, Ge Yixiao et al., ECCV 2020 | github | bibtex
- Stochastic Attraction-Repulsion Embedding for Large Scale Image Localization, Liu Liu et al., ICCV 2019 | bibtex
- Attention-based Pyramid Aggregation Network for Visual Place Recognition, Yingying Zhu et al., ACM MM 2018 | bibtex
- Learned Contextual Feature Reweighting for Image Geo-Localization, Kim Hyo Jin et al., CVPR 2017 | bibtex
- NetVLAD: CNN architecture for weakly supervised place recognition, Relja Arandjelović et al., CVPR 2016 | github | bibtex
- Visual Place Recognition with Repetitive Structures, A. Torii et al., PAMI 2015 | bibtex
- Learning and Calibrating Per-Location Classifiers for Visual Place Recognition, Gronat Petr et al., CVPR 2013 | bibtex
VPR Datasets
- Rethinking Visual Geo-localization for Large-Scale Applications, Berton Gabriele et al., CVPR 2022 | github | bibtex
- GSV-Cities: Toward appropriate supervised visual place recognition, Ali-bey Amar et al., Neurocomputing 2022 | github | bibtex
- AmsterTime: A Visual Place Recognition Benchmark Dataset for Severe Domain Shift, B. Yildiz et al., ICPR 2022 | bibtex
- Adaptive-Attentive Geolocalization From Few Queries: A Hybrid Approach, Berton Gabriele et al., WACV 2021 | github | bibtex
- Google Landmarks Dataset v2 – A Large-Scale Benchmark for Instance-Level Recognition and Retrieval, Tobias Weyand et al., CVPR 2020 | github | bibtex
- Mapillary Street-Level Sequences: A Dataset for Lifelong Place Recognition, Warburg Frederik et al., CVPR 2020 | github | bibtex
- 24/7 Place Recognition by View Synthesis, A. Torii et al., PAMI 2018 | bibtex
- Benchmarking 6DOF Outdoor Visual Localization in Changing Conditions, T. Sattler et al., cvpr 2018 | bibtex
- 1 Year, 1000km: The Oxford RobotCar Dataset, W. Maddern et al., IJRR 2017 | website | bibtex
- The SYNTHIA Dataset: A Large Collection of Synthetic Images for Semantic Segmentation of Urban Scenes, G. Ros et al., cvpr 2016 | bibtex
- University of Michigan North Campus long-term vision and lidar dataset, N. Carlevaris-Bianco et al., ijrr 2016 | webisite | bibtex
- Image Geo-localization Based on Multiple Nearest Neighbor Feature Matching using Generalized Graphs, Zamir A.R. et al., PAMI 2014 | website | bibtex
- Vision meets robotics: The KITTI dataset, A Geiger et al., IJRR 2013 | website | bibtex
- Are we there yet? Challenging SeqSLAM on a 3000 km journey across all four seasons, N. Suenderhauf et al., ICRAW 2013 | bibtex
- Image retrieval for image-based localization revisited, Torsten Sattler et al., cvpr 2012 | bibtex
- City-scale landmark identification on mobile devices, D. M. Chen et al., CVPR 2011 | bibtex
- Avoiding confusing features in place recognition, Knopp J. et al., ECCV 2010 | bibtex
- Highly scalable appearance-only SLAM - FAB-MAP 2.0, M. Cummins et al., RSS 2009 | bibtex
- Mapping a Suburb With a Single Camera Using a Biologically Inspired SLAM System, Michael Milford et al., TRO 2008 | bibtex
Cross-domain VPR
- Adaptive-Attentive Geolocalization From Few Queries: A Hybrid Approach, Berton Gabriele et al., WACV 2021 | github | bibtex
- Inside Out Visual Place Recognition, Sarah Ibrahimi et al., BMVC 2021 | github | bibtex
- Night-to-day image translation for retrieval-based localization, Anoosheh Asha et al., ICRA 2019 | bibtex
- Attention-Aware Age-Agnostic Visual Place Recognition, Ziqi Wang et al., ICCVW 2019 | bibtex
- Lazy Data Association For Image Sequences Matching Under Substantial Appearance Changes, Olga Vysotska et al., RAL 2016 | bibtex
Sequence-based VPR
- Learning Sequence Descriptor based on Spatio-Temporal Attention for Visual Place Recognition, Fenglin Zhang et al., ArXiv 2023 | bibtex
- MATC-Net: Learning compact sequence representation for hierarchical loop closure detection, Fuji Fu et al., 2023 | bibtex
- Learning Sequential Descriptors for Sequence-Based Visual Place Recognition, Riccardo Mereu et al., RAL 2022 | github | bibtex
- SeqNet: Learning Descriptors for Sequence-based Hierarchical Place Recognition, Sourav Garg et al., RAL 2021 | github | bibtex
- Fast and Memory Efficient Graph Optimization via ICM for Visual Place Recognition, Stefan Schubert et al., RSS 2021 | bibtex
- SeqSLAM: Visual route-based navigation for sunny summer days and stormy winter nights, Michael Milford et al., ICRA 2012 | bibtex
Re-ranking
- Towards Seamless Adaptation of Pre-trained Models for Visual Place Recognition, Feng Lu et al., ICLR 2024 | github | bibtex
- Are Local Features All You Need for Cross-Domain Visual Place Recognition?, Giovanni Barbarani et al., CVPRW 2023 | github | bibtex
- R2former: Unified retrieval and reranking transformer for place recognition, Sijie Zhu et al., CVPR 2023 | github | bibtex
- TransVPR: Transformer-Based Place Recognition With Multi-Level Attention Aggregation, Wang Ruotong et al., CVPR 2022 | bibtex
- Correlation Verification for Image Retrieval, Lee Seongwon et al., CVPR 2022 | github | bibtex
- Viewpoint Invariant Dense Matching for Visual Geolocalization, Berton Gabriele et al., ICCV 2021 | github | bibtex
- Patch-NetVLAD: Multi-Scale Fusion of Locally-Global Descriptors for Place Recognition, Hausler Stephen et al., CVPR 2021 | github | bibtex
- LoFTR: Detector-Free Local Feature Matching with Transformers, Sun Jiaming et al., CVPR 2021 | github | bibtex
- Instance-level Image Retrieval using Reranking Transformers, Fuwen Tan et al., ICCV 2021 | github | bibtex
- DenserNet: Weakly Supervised Visual Localization Using Multi-scale Feature Aggregation, Liu Dongfang et al., AAAI 2021 | bibtex
- Unifying Deep Local and Global Features for Image Search, B. Cao et al., eccv 2020 | bibtex
- SuperGlue: Learning Feature Matching with Graph Neural Networks, Paul-Edouard Sarlin and et al., CVPR 2020 | github | bibtex
- R2D2: Repeatable and Reliable Detector and Descriptor, Jerome Revaud et al., NIPS 2019 | github | bibtex
- D2-Net: A Trainable CNN for Joint Detection and Description of Local Features, Dusmanu Mihai et al., CVPR 2019 | github | bibtex
- Large-Scale Image Retrieval with Attentive Deep Local Features, Noh Hyeonwoo et al., ICCV 2017 | bibtex
Benchmarks
- Are Local Features All You Need for Cross-Domain Visual Place Recognition?, Giovanni Barbarani et al., CVPRW 2023 | github | bibtex
- Deep Visual Geo-localization Benchmark, Berton Gabriele et al., CVPR 2022 | github | bibtex
- VPR-Bench: An Open-Source Visual Place Recognition Evaluation Framework with Quantifiable Viewpoint and Appearance Change, Zaffar Mubariz et al., IJCV 2021 | github | bibtex
- Benchmarking Image Retrieval for Visual Localization, Pion Noe et al., 3DV 2020 | bibtex
- Benchmarking 6DOF Outdoor Visual Localization in Changing Conditions, T. Sattler et al., cvpr 2018 | bibtex
World-wide Geo-Localization
- Interpretable Semantic Photo Geolocation, Theiner Jonas et al., WACV 2022 | github | bibtex
- Where in the World is this Image? Transformer-based Geo-localization in the Wild, Pramanick Shraman et al., ECCV 2022 | github | bibtex
- Leveraging EfficientNet and Contrastive Learning for Accurate Global-scale Location Estimation, Giorgos Kordopatis-Zilos et al., ICMR 2021 | github | bibtex
- Geolocation Estimation of Photos Using a Hierarchical Model and Scene Classification, Muller-Budack Eric et al., ECCV 2018 | github | bibtex
- CPlaNet: Enhancing Image Geolocalization by Combinatorial Partitioning of Maps, Paul Hongsuck Seo et al., ECCV 2018 | github | bibtex
- Revisiting IM2GPS in the Deep Learning Era, Vo Nam et al., ICCV 2017 | bibtex
- PlaNet - Photo Geolocation with Convolutional Neural Networks, Tobias Weyand et al., ECCV 2016 | bibtex
- IM2GPS: estimating geographic information from a single image, James Hays et al., CVPR 2008 | bibtex
Others
- Divide&Classify: Fine-Grained Classification for City-Wide Visual Geo-localization, Gabriele Trivigno et al., ICCV 2023 | github | bibtex
- Unifying Visual Localization and Scene Recognition for People With Visual Impairment, R. Cheng et al., IEEE Access 2020 | bibtex
- Scalable Place Recognition Under Appearance Change for Autonomous Driving, A. D. Doan et al., ICCV 2019 | bibtex
- Multi-Process Fusion: Visual Place Recognition Using Multiple Image Processing Methods, S. Hausler et al., ral 2019 | github | bibtex
- Semantic–geometric visual place recognition: a new perspective for reconciling opposing views, S. Garg et al., IJRR 2019 | bibtex
- Are Large-Scale 3D Models Really Necessary for Accurate Visual Localization?, A. Torii et al., PAMI 2021 | bibtex
- Benchmarking urban visual geo-localization, Carlo Masone, CVPR 2023
- Urban visual geo-localization: towards large-scale applications, Gabriele Berton, CVPR 2023
- Large-Scale Visual Localization, Giorgos Tolias, Yannis Avrithis, Zuzana Kukelova, Torsten Sattler, Sudipta n: Sinha, Eric Brachmann, ICCV 2021
- General Place Recognition Competition, Yimin Zhang, Luca Carlone, Michael Milford, Junyan Zhu, Ji Zhang, Sebastian Scherer, ICRA 2022
- Tutorial : Large-Scale Visual Place Recognition and Image-Based Localization Part 1, Akihiko Torii, Giorgos Tolias, CVPR 2017
- Tutorial : Large-Scale Visual Place Recognition and Image-Based Localization Part 2, Torsten Sattler, Alex Kendall, CVPR 2017
MIT